Default Rearing Bearing Leaking Grease??

I was changing my rear brakes yesterday and noticed an excessive amount of grease on the inside of my rim and all over my brake caliper...I cleaned all the grease up and wiped everything clean and install my new brakes. Checked this morning and It seems to be leaking a bit of grease still. I had the half axle and bearing replaced a few months ago and have had no issues until now. Could it be a bad bearing seal? What else should I be concerned with? Thanks in advanced.
